Resumen de Use of YOLOv4 and Yolov4Tiny for Intelligent Vehicle Detection in Smart City Environments

Daniel Hernández de la Iglesia, Hector Sánchez San Blas, Vivian Félix López Batista, María Navelonga Moreno García, María Dolores Muñoz Vicente, Raul García Ovejero, Gabriel Villarrubia González, Juan Francisco de Paz Santana

  • One of the biggest problems in cities today is the significant increase in the number of motor vehicles. Intelligent traffic control is a fundamental part of controlling city travel. To achieve this goal, it is very important to have sensor technologies capable of identifying the number of vehicles traveling on a road. In this paper, we propose the development of a classifier model capable of reliably counting the number of vehicles in urban areas. In this case, it is proposed the construction of a dataset to carry out the training of a model based on YOLOv4 and YOLOv4Tiny systems that can be embedded in intelligent traffic light systems.
